いくつかのアップグレードの後、emacs23 が正常に動作しなくなりました。メイン メニューの一部の項目を開けませんでした。F10の後、彼らは働き始めます。emacs を再インストールしましたが、役に立ちません。(Dell Latitudeでubuntu 10.10を使用しています)。どんな提案にも感謝します。
4 に答える
もっと具体的に教えてください。通常M-x accelerate-menu
、メニュー オプションが展開されない場合に役立ちます。
最新の emacs23 を試すこともできます: https://launchpad.net/~ubuntu-elisp/+archive/ppa。実際、10.10 リポジトリにある 23.1 で正しく動作しないライブラリがいくつかありました。
TED の提案に追加するには:.emacs
ファイルをデバッグしようとするときは、バイナリ検索を使用してください。その半分を ( command を使用してcomment-region
) コメントアウトし、次に 3/4、次に 7/8... をコメントアウトして、原因を突き止めます。コマンドcomment-region
はまた、リージョンのコメントを*un*します -- そのドキュメントをチェックしてください。
新しい emacs バージョンを使用すると、頻繁に機能しないという問題があります。通常、動作しなくなったのは私の古いカスタム emacs のものです。(20世紀にさかのぼるいくつかの行がまだそこにあります)。
ファイルの名前を別の名前に変更してみてください.emacs
(もちろん、新しい emacs セッションを開始してください)。これで問題が解決した場合は、元に戻し、原因が見つかるまでその一部を選択的にコメントアウトします。
site-lisp を emacs ツリー自体以外の場所に設定している場合は、そこにある可能性もあります (ただし、通常は、上記のように .emacs ファイルを介して開始することができます)。emacs ツリーの外に site-lisp が設定されていない場合、.emacs ファイルが新しいインストールの site-lisp ディレクトリにない何かを site-lisp で探している可能性があります。